The Journey to a Simple, Powerful Prayer
In Before Amen, Max Lucado takes us on a journey to simplify and strengthen our prayers. He opens by acknowledging that many of us struggle with prayer, often due to the complexity of the process. Lucado shares his own experiences of feeling inadequate in prayer and emphasizes that we don't need fancy words or a certain posture to communicate with God.
Lucado introduces a simple prayer that encapsulates the essence of all prayers, "Father, You are good. I need help. They need help. Thank you. In Jesus' name, amen." This prayer, according to Lucado, covers all the bases. It acknowledges God's goodness, asks for help, intercedes for others, expresses gratitude, and ends with the powerful name of Jesus.
Understanding God's Authority and Love
Lucado then delves into the concept of God as our shepherd, drawing from the biblical imagery of shepherds and sheep. He emphasizes that God is not just a distant deity, but a caring shepherd who knows us intimately and desires to guide us. Understanding God's authority and love helps us approach Him with confidence, knowing that He has our best interests at heart.
This understanding also helps us trust God's sovereignty in our lives. Lucado shares the story of his daughter's illness and how he learned to trust God despite the circumstances. He encourages us to let go of our need for control and instead surrender to God's loving authority.
The Power of a Simple, Consistent Prayer Life
Building on the simple prayer formula introduced earlier, Lucado highlights the importance of consistency in our prayer life. He compares our prayers to a child's repetitive requests, emphasizing that God doesn't tire of our prayers. Instead, our consistent communication with Him deepens our relationship and trust in Him.
Lucado also addresses the issue of unanswered prayers, reminding us that God's ways are higher than our ways. He encourages us to continue praying and trusting God's timing and wisdom. Our simple, consistent prayers, he explains, may not change our circumstances, but they will change us. They will deepen our faith and trust in God.
Embracing a Life of Prayer
In the final section of Before Amen, Lucado encourages us to embrace a life of prayer. He emphasizes that prayer isn't just a ritual or a religious duty, but a lifeline to God. It is the means by which we connect with our Creator, share our hearts, and experience His presence.
Lucado concludes by reminding us that our prayers don't have to be perfect. God isn't looking for flawless, eloquent prayers; He's looking for sincere, humble hearts. So, we can approach Him just as we are, with our simple, heartfelt prayers. In doing so, we can experience the peace, strength, and joy that comes from a life of prayer.
